IRVINE, Calif., Aug. 31, 2017 -- Khang & Khang LLP (the “Firm”) announces a securities class action lawsuit against Applied Optoelectronics, Inc. (“Applied Optoelectronics” or the “Company”) (Nasdaq:AAOI). According to the Complaint, throughout the Class Period, Applied Optoelectronics made false and/or misleading statements and/or failed to disclose: that a major customer was decreasing its purchases of the Company’s 40G receivers; that the loss of this major customer’s business would have a significant negative impact on the Company’s financial performance; and that as a result of the above, the Company’s public statements were materially false and misleading at all relevant times. When this information reached the public, shares of Applied Optoelectronics dropped in value materially, which caused investors harm according to the Complaint.
